I would actually think Weld could/should expose this, not CDI. As exposing TM is definitely not per spec, hence not CDI's "business". Otoh, building Tx based Seam3 components would again depend on Weld workaround; e.g. Seam Conversation.
TM also exposes XAResource handling, for which TxServices don't have matching api. And like I said, there is also suspend/resume Tx API, which sometimes also comes in handy. If TxServices::getTM returns an actual TM instance, then Weld could expose it as a bean.
